As you can see (at least I can anyway, and so do my doctors), my lower jaw is recessed...or shorter than my upper jaw. This has caused an incorrect bit, which causes pressure in my joints, which causes the cracking and popping and the occasional inability to open my mouth wide enough to stick a toothbrush in.

An X-ray even revealed that my joint is starting to deteriorate because of the abnormal pressure. AKA--I have arthritis in my jaw. Fun! Fun? No...not really. Because, not only does it make chewing difficult and causes migraine like symptoms on occasion, but it hampers a lot of other activities as well...but I digress.
